The Duke The series was based on Oscar Ramsey, a prizefighter turned private detective in the streets of Chicago. Alongside "The Duke" (Robert Conrad), who had connections on both sides of the law was actor/stuntman Red West (see also Coach of the Year) who played the role of Sgt. Mick O'Brien. Red wrote a song used in the "Nothing 'Cept Noise" episode called "Down on Wilson Avenue" that Mrs. Conrad (singer/actress LaVelda Fann) sang. The song was recorded in Dick Marx's studio in 1979. |
